Output 3dd6d240ebe2e1335e20d5ce246e18bb2d16729d17abfa70f67a46c9d01b386f:1

value
18051059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b3829400dcf740d558f2550080b3ce651558f3 OP_EQUAL
address
3EhYvMxCyHp7tkQSEaKvuEbe7HbgabDwc1
transaction
3dd6d240ebe2e1335e20d5ce246e18bb2d16729d17abfa70f67a46c9d01b386f
confirmations
504286
spent
true